Emoticons
ForumSpark allows you to define custom emoticons that users can include in their posts using shortcodes.
You can access the Emoticons panel from the Board Config section in the Admin Control Panel.
Adding a New Emoticon
To add a new emoticon, provide the following:
- Text to replace: This is the shortcode users will type, such as
:wave:or:). When the post is rendered, this text will be replaced by the associated image. - Image URL: The full URL to the image to use for the emoticon. This must be a valid image format (e.g.
.png,.gif,.jpg). - Display order: Determines where the emoticon appears in the selection list. Lower numbers appear first.
- Show in list: If enabled, the emoticon will appear in the emoticon picker UI. You can keep this off for hidden or rarely used emoticons.

Notes
- Emoticons are parsed after BBCode, so make sure your shortcodes don't interfere with any formatting tags.
- Avoid using very large images. Aim for small icons (e.g. 16–32px square) for consistency.
- You can upload emoticon images directly to your board using the File Manager in the Admin Control Panel. After uploading, copy the URL from the file list and use it in the Image URL field.
Once saved, the new emoticon will be available for use across all posts, shoutbox and private messages.
